在区块链技术快速发展的今天,跨链技术成为了连接不同区块链平台的关键。它允许不同平台上的区块链之间进行资产和信息的交换,从而实现真正的去中心化互联网。本文将深入解析跨链技术的概念、原理、不同平台类型下的应用,以及它对区块链生态系统的影响。
跨链技术的概念与原理
概念
跨链技术是指实现不同区块链平台之间数据交换和资产转移的技术。它旨在打破各个区块链孤岛的限制,实现不同区块链之间的互联互通。
原理
跨链技术通常涉及以下几个关键组成部分:
- 桥接机制:作为不同区块链之间的桥梁,桥接机制负责实现数据交换和资产转移。
- 共识机制:跨链技术需要一种共识机制来确保不同区块链之间的数据一致性和安全性。
- 跨链合约:跨链合约用于封装跨链逻辑,确保数据交换和资产转移的透明性和可追溯性。
不同平台类型下的跨链应用
公有链
公有链如比特币和以太坊是最早应用跨链技术的平台。这些平台上的跨链技术主要包括:
- 以太坊跨链协议:如Polkadot和Cosmos,它们通过提供互操作性来连接不同的区块链。
- 比特币跨链技术:如Ripple和Stellar,它们通过侧链或原子交换来实现跨链功能。
私有链
私有链通常在企业内部使用,跨链技术可以增强不同企业之间区块链系统的互操作性。常见的应用包括:
- Hyperledger Fabric:支持跨链通信,允许企业之间的区块链系统进行数据交换。
- Quorum:一个基于以太坊的私有链解决方案,支持跨链交易。
联盟链
联盟链是由多个组织共同维护的区块链,跨链技术可以促进不同联盟链之间的合作。例如:
- Hyperledger Burrow:支持跨链通信,允许不同联盟链之间的数据共享。
- ConsenSys Quorum:提供跨链解决方案,支持联盟链之间的资产转移。
跨链技术对区块链生态系统的影响
提高互操作性
跨链技术使得不同区块链平台之间能够无缝交互,从而提高了整个区块链生态系统的互操作性。
促进创新
跨链技术为开发者提供了更多可能性,使他们能够构建跨平台的应用程序和服务。
增强安全性
通过引入共识机制和跨链合约,跨链技术提高了区块链系统的安全性。
降低成本
跨链技术减少了企业之间进行数据交换和资产转移的成本。
总之,跨链技术是连接不同区块链平台的关键,它将为区块链生态系统带来更多可能性。随着技术的不断发展和完善,我们有理由相信,跨链技术将在未来发挥更加重要的作用。
